Quarriers Sweep Canton in Double-Header

February 16,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

NewDRLogoThe Dell Rapids Quarrier girls and boy steams both earned victories over the Canton C-Hawks on Monday, February 15th, in Canton.  The games were postponed to Monday from an earlier date due to snow.

The Quarrier girls earned a 42-24 win over Canton to improve to 12-7 on the year.  Dell Rapids continues to hold the top spot in Region 3A with only one more game to go.  The Quarriers will travel to Madison on Thursday, February 18th, for their final regular season game of the year.   Mikaela Stofferahn is only nine points away from 1,000 career points.  The game can be seen on Big Sioux Media.

The Quarrier boys picked up a 51-31 win over the C-Hawks.  The Dell Rapids defense held Canton to just seven total second half points.  Ty Hoglund finished with 23 points while Jeffrey Schuch had 10 points.  Dell Rapids improves to 17-1 on the year.  The Quarriers will have their final home game of the year on Friday, February 19th, when they host Lennox.  The game can be seen on Big Sioux Media.

Quarrier Girls Bounce Back at Dakota Valley

February 13,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

NewDRLogoThe Dell Rapids Quarriers won their fourth game out of their last five on Friday, February 12th.  The Quarriers defeated the Dakota Valley Panthers 58-46 at Dakota Valley High School.

Dell Rapids held Dakota Valley to just 14 total first half points, seven points in each of the quarters.  The Quarriers, meanwhile, scored 27 and led 27-14 at halftime.  The Panthers cut the lead to 39-30 at the end of the third quarter, but Dell Rapids outscored Dakota Valley 19-16 in the final quarter for the win.

The Quarriers shot 37% from the field, 50% from three-point area, and 69% from the free-throw line.  Dakota Valley finished the night shooting 35% from the field, 27% from the three-point area, and 62% from the free-throw line.

Two Quarriers finished the night with double-doubles.  Mikaela Stofferahn had 20 points and 11 rebounds, and Emma Paul had 16 points and 13 rebounds.  Stofferahn had four steals, and Paul had four steals.

Dell Rapids (11-7) will travel to Canton on Monday, February 15th.

Quarrier Girls Win Third Straight on Senior Night

February 7,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

DRHS_TV_GBB_SeniorNight2016The Dell Rapids Quarrier girls earned their third straight win by defeating the Tri-Valley Mustangs 49-39 in the final home game of the regular season on Friday, January 5th.

Dell Rapids started the game on a big run that gave them a lead they would never lose.  The Quarriers opened up the game on an 18-4 run over the first seven minutes and ended the first quarter leading 18-6.  The Quarriers pushed the lead to 20 by halftime at 32-12.  Tri-Valley made a bit of a run the second half.  With 2:11 to go in the third quarter, Dell Rapids led 39-19.  The Mustangs outscored the Quarriers 20-10 the remainder of the game, but it wasn’t enough to overtake Dell Rapids.

Two players scored in double-figures on the night for the Quarriers.  Mikaela Stofferahn finished with 15 points.  Sami Reider added 13 points.  Nikole Krump led Tri-Valley with 14 points.

The Quarriers (10-6) travel to Mt Vernon to play the #2 ranked Mt Vernon/Plankinton Titans on Tuesday, February 9th, as part of a girls and boys double-header.

Quarrier Girls Win at Dak-12 Classic

January 31,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

NewDRLogoThe Dell Rapids Quarrier girls basketball team defeated the Tri-Valley Mustangs at that Dak-12 Conference Classic held at Dakota Valley High School on Saturday, January 30th.  Dell Rapids beat the Mustangs 39-23.

The Quarriers outscored Tri-Valley in every quarter and also held the Mustangs to just seven total points in the second half.  Dell Rapids led after the first quarter 11-7.  They extended their lead to 23-16 at halftime.  Tri-Valley scored just five points in third quarter, and Dell Rapids pushed their lead to eight at 29-21 by the end of the quarter.  The Quarriers then held the Mustangs to just two fourth quarter points.

Mikaela Stofferahn finished the game with 18 points and eight rebounds.  Emma Paul had 12 points, six rebounds, and two steals.   Arial Hoffman and Lindsey Morris also had two steals in the game.  Dell Rapids finished the game shooing just 28% from the field and 57% from the free-throw line.

Dell Rapids (9-6) will travel to Canton to play the Canton C-Hawks on Tuesday, February 2nd.

Quarrier Girls Earn Dak12 Win in Vermillion

January 29,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

NewDRLogoThe Dell Rapids Quarrier girls ended their three-game skid with a Dak-12 Conference win over the Vermillion Tanagers 54-44 on Thursday, January 28th, in Vermillion.  Dell Rapids held just a one-point lead at 19-18 halftime.  The Quarriers extended their lead to six at 31-25 by the end of the third quarter.

Arial Hoffman and Mikaela Stofferahn led the Quarrier’s second half surge.  Stofferahn scored eight of her 16 points in the third quarter, while Hoffman scored 11 of her 18 points in the fourth quarter.  Emma Paul and Kaylee Hennen both finished with six points.  Dell Rapids had a total of 39 team rebounds.

The Quarriers (8-6) will play the Tri-Valley Mustangs at the Dak-12 Conference Classic on Saturday, January 30th, held at Dakota Valley High School at 1:30 p.m.

Sioux Valley Squeaks by Quarrier Girls

January 23,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

DRHSvsSV_GBB_1-22-16A late three-point basket by Carly Granum with just under 1:00 to play in the game proved to be the winning basket for the Sioux Valley Cossacks.  Sioux Valley stole a victory from Dell Rapids 48-43 at Dell Rapids High School on Friday, January 22nd.

The #3 rated Cossacks led 12-9 at the end of the first quarter.  Dell Rapids, however, went on an 11-0 run in the second quarter and took at 27-22 lead by halftime.  The third quarter was filled with runs.  The Quarriers scored the first three points of the third quarter to take a 30-22 lead, their largest of the night.  Sioux Valley answered with an 8-0 run and tied the game at 30-30 with 6:15 to go in the third quarter.  Dell Rapids scored the next five point and led 35-30 with 3:33 to go in the quarter, but it was Sioux Valley that scored the final six points of the quarter to take a 36-35 lead.

Within the first minute of the fourth quarter, Dell Rapids scored five unanswered points and led 40-36 after a layup by Arial Hoffman with 7:19 to play in the game.  The Cossacks regained the lead with 3:26 to go at 43-42.  Hoffman knocked down a free throw to tie the game at 43-43 with 3:09 to go.  Neither team scored until Granum hit a three-point shot with with :56 left in the game.  Kaylee Granum added two free throws with :13.6 to seal the win.

Dell Rapids was led by Mikaela Stofferahn with 14 points.  The Quarriers (7-5) travel to Elk Point to take on the Elk Point-Jefferson Huskies as part of a double-header.

West Central Snaps Quarrier Girls Streak

January 21,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

NewDRLogoThe Dell Rapids Quarrier girls had their four-game winning streak snapped by the West Central Trojans on Tuesday, January 19th, in Hartford.  The Trojans defeated the Quarriers 61-47.  West Central led at the end of every quarter break and were able to answer every run that Dell Rapids made.

The Trojans held a 16-10 lead at the end of the first quarter, and then they extended that lead to 32-21 at halftime.  Dell Rapids was able to get the game within single digits multiple times in the second half, but every time the Quarriers got close, the Trojans answered.  West Central led 49-35 at the end of the third quarter and maintained that lead for the win.

Dell Rapids (7-4) will host undefeated #3 Sioux Valley Cossacks on Friday, January 23rd.  The game can be seen on Big Sioux Media.

Quarrier Girls Win Fourth Straight

January 17,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

NewDRLogoThe Dell Rapids Quarrier girls defeated the Andes Central/Dakota Christian (AC/DC) Thunder 48-35 at the Hanson Classic at the Mitchell Corn Palace on Saturday, January 16th.

The game featured five ties and 11 lead changes.  Dell Rapids held a 5-4 lead after the first quarter.  The Thunder took the lead in the second quarter and held their largest lead at five points with 5:34 to go in the second quarter.  However, the Quarriers regained the lead and went into the locker room at halftime ahead 17-16.  Dell Rapids pulled away in the second half by outscoring the Thunder 31-19 in the final two quarters for the win.

The Quarriers shot 35% (15-43) from the field and 78% (18-23) from the free-throw line.  Dell Rapids was a perfect 13-13 in the second half from the free-throw line.  The Quarriers had a total of 32 team rebounds and eight steals.

Mikaela Stofferahn led all scorers with 14 points.  Stofferahn also had five rebounds and two assists.  Emma Paul finished with 12 points, five rebounds, and four steals.  Kaylee Hennen and Averi Pankonen each had six points.  Arial Hoffman and Pankonen both had five rebounds.

Dell Rapids (7-3) travels to Hartford to take on the West Central Trojans on Tuesday, January 19th.

Quarrier Girls Win Third Straight

January 11,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

NewDRLogoThe Dell Rapids Quarrier girls won their third straight game on Monday, January 11th, at Dell Rapids High School.  The Quarriers defeated the Lennox Orioles 58-45.  Dell Rapids led at every quarter break in the game.

The Quarriers held a slight two-point lead at the end of the first quarter at 14-12.  The lead for Dell Rapids grew to six points by halftime at 29-23.  Dell Rapids opened up the third quarter on a 6-0 run and led by 12 points early in the third quarter.  The Orioles would get the lead into single digits a couple of times in the quarter, but Dell Rapids ended the third quarter ahead by 13 at 46-33.  Each team scored 12 points in the final quarter.

Three players scored in double figures for Dell Rapids.  Mikaela Stofferahn had 17 points.  Emma Paul finished with 13 points, and Averi Pankonen added 10 points.  Jordan Kruse led Lennox with 16 points.

Dell Rapids (6-3) will face Andes Central/Dakota Christian at the Hanson Classic in Mitchell at 9:00 a.m. on Saturday, January 16th.

Quarriers Sweep Beresford in Double-Header

January 10, 2016 by Matt Larson, Big Sioux Media

NewDRLogoThe Dell Rapids Quarrier girls and boys teams both earned wins over the Beresford Watchdogs on Thursday, January 7th, at Dell Rapids High School.  The girls earned a 46-25 win while the boys team won 72-53.

The girls team led from start to finish.  The Quarriers had a 10 point lead after the first quarter 16-6.  The lead had grown to 12 points by halftime at 25-13.  Dell Rapids kept rolling in the second half extending their lead to 39-21 by the end of the third quarter.

The boys team also led at every quarter break.  Dell Rapids led 18-10 after the first quarter, but outscored Beresford 24-14 too take 42-24 lead into halftime.  The Quarriers added 22 more points in third quarter and pushed their lead to 64-37 by the end of the quarter.

The Quarrier girls team (5-3) will host Lennox on Monday, January 11th.  The game can be seen on Big Sioux Media.  The Quarrier boys team (5-1) travel to Chamberlain on Friday, January 8th.
